GRAMMY Award winner Flaco Jimenez has died at the age of 86.
The music star died surrounded by his family on July 31.
Jimenez, who hailed from San Antonio, was known for his Tex Mex and Tejano music.
His death comes just months after being hospitalized over a “medical hurdle.”
““It is with great sadness that we share tonight the loss of our father,” his family said.
They said he will be “missed immensely.”
During his career, he picked up six Grammy Awards.
In 2015, he won the Grammy Lifetime Achievement award.
